Transaction 0442feb94de8d28476edd72fa8c657e1eb640f3004c49e5cc82a7183f07ba910
1 Input
2 Outputs
- 0442feb94de8d28476edd72fa8c657e1eb640f3004c49e5cc82a7183f07ba910:0
- 0442feb94de8d28476edd72fa8c657e1eb640f3004c49e5cc82a7183f07ba910:1
value 18405860
address 3M7bfRQnuuEtXYELWnpW75ydTqk3g2CqwV
value 1212900
address 1K7Fz4jyqrrvMEYTSkRwVdDQ4aP4z2KQa4